What is Devil’s Blight?
Devil’s Blight is a rare mushroom that can be harvested, mostly found at the end game of Monster Hunter Wilds. While it is rarely used in any crafting recipe, it is found in the Mega Barrel Bomb craft, which comes in handy for post-game content.
Barrel Bombs are upgraded through Fire Herbs and Small Bombs, and then these can be upgraded to Large Barrel Bombs with Gunpowder. Once you have these Large Barrel Bombs, they can be upgraded to the Mega Barrel Bombs through Devil’s Blight. Unlike the others, this can be rolled towards a target due to its size, and doesn’t need to be triggered via a projectile or strike.

Where to Find Devil’s Blight
Oilwell Basin
The earliest you’re able to get your hands on Devil’s Blight is the third area, Oilwell Basin, but even then the resources are fairly limited. There are only two spots in the area where you can harvest these mushrooms, and even then, they can be tricky to spot because they are simply a darker shade of red on the map compared to the Nitroshrooms. The first location is found on the bottom floor of the Oilwell Basin inzone 15. This can be found on the map right next to the 15 indicator. The second location is also on the bottom floor and found all the way southwest inbetween areas 16 and 18. There needs to be a bit of traversal to get to these mushrooms, but there is also a portable camp site that can be put down for ease of access.
Ruins of Wyveria
The final area of the campaign, as you might expect, these are a little bit more plentiful. Even then, though, the Devil’s Blight is fairly scarce. The first place you should be looking to get to iszone 4. Located directlynorthwest of the 4 iconon the map, you’ll find two Devil Blights to be picked on an elevated platform. The next can be found all the waynortheastof this position. you may get this when coming down on the branches, but you’ll need to use your grappling hook to grab it because it’s located in an accessible area, at least on foot. Finally, the last instance of Devil’s Blight can be found inzone 5all the way south of the second floor next to a mineral deposit.
